Camera iPhone Apps — 12 April 2010

It was only a matter of time until an iPad app emerged that could provide the tablet computer with a wireless camera, and that day is today. Called Camera B and Camera A, the applications respectively connect your iPhone 3Gs (not 3G) to your iPad via Bluetooth and provides the aforementioned feature. To snap a pic you just hit a button at the bottom of the Camera A application.
Will it work with Skype? Probably not, but I’m sure that’s something somebody, namely Skype, should work to resolve.
The Camera A app (iPad) costs $0.99, while Camera B (iPhone) is free.
